Welsh star Matthew Rhys has made Emmy history by winning two best lead actor awards at the same ceremony.
Widow's Bay, which stars the 51-year-old, also set a new record for the most wins of a comedy series in the history of the awards.
With a haul of 14 statuettes, the dark comedy's Welsh star took best actor, and then made history himself by bagging the best actor in a limited series for psychological thriller, The Beast In Me.

Taken together with his 2018 drama win for The Americans, he is the first male performer to win in all three lead acting categories.
Picking up his second prize of the night at the Peacock Theatre in Los Angeles, Rhys paid tribute to "the great and good people of Wales", which he hailed as "a small but mighty nation".
Speaking backstage, holding both Emmys, Rhys said: "The celebrations will be long, varied, and I hope at times wild."
